OrganiGram Holdings Inc. experienced a significant drop in its stock price, closing down 8.76% in the latest trading session.

In a disappointing turn of events, OrganiGram Holdings Inc (OGI.TO) saw its stock price tumble by 8.76% in the last trading session, closing at CA$1.25. This decline raises concerns about the company’s recent performance and investor sentiment.

Stock Price Decline of 8.76%

OrganiGram's market cap now stands at CA$192.86 million, reflecting investor concerns after a rough trading day.

Bull case

Despite the recent drop, OrganiGram has potential for growth. The company’s acquisition of Sanity Group and reported revenue increases in its latest fiscal results show promise for the future.

Bear case

However, the significant drop in stock price may indicate underlying issues, such as market volatility or investor skepticism, especially considering the company's negative profit margin.

OrganiGram's stock price fell sharply in the last session, closing at CA$1.25. This decline raises questions about the company's ability to maintain investor confidence, particularly after its recent acquisition of Sanity Group and reported revenue growth.

Market Sentiment and Future Outlook

The stock's performance reflects broader market sentiment, which may be influenced by OrganiGram's ongoing challenges, including a negative profit margin of -9.2%. Investors should remain vigilant about upcoming earnings reports and market reactions.

What Lies Ahead for OrganiGram

With a market cap of CA$192.86 million and ongoing developments in the cannabis sector, OrganiGram's future depends on its ability to navigate market challenges and seize growth opportunities. Investors can follow more about OrganiGram's journey on their stock page.
